Fun with webms Plain Text
00:50:53 n-tech @ __uguu__ you were right about those seek headers 00:51:01 n-tech I'm glad you told me about them before, because I knew were to start looking 00:51:07 n-tech but it's still really difficult to do right 00:51:38 StephenLynx the thing on headers that you use to stream media? 00:51:50 n-tech yes 00:52:13 StephenLynx yeah, it took me the whole afternoon to implement that when I added webm. 00:55:21 __uguu__ n-tech: the what? 00:55:37 n-tech content headers for http responses when streaming parts of video files 00:55:41 __uguu__ oh yeah 00:55:55 __uguu__ that's the most annoying part about http.log on my hidden service 00:56:48 __uguu__ tons of 206 [...] 01:06:07 StephenLynx what most pissed me off was off-setting correctly according to the informed range in the header. 01:06:17 StephenLynx I got a good half-hour figuring that part. 01:13:50 n-tech @ __uguu__ please test seeking 01:13:51 n-tech http://infinitydev.org/test/file/4d95b3b0377c82aba399a07db6087fb6/1440702842449.webm 01:13:58 n-tech I think it works but I'm too excited to make rational calls lol 01:14:28 StephenLynx excited? anything new? 01:14:34 __uguu__ how's the load? 01:14:47 n-tech excited because 206 responses are working 01:14:51 StephenLynx ah 01:15:43 * __uguu__ weeeeh 01:15:57 __uguu__ n-tech: how's the load now? 01:16:09 n-tech what do you mean by load? the webserver load? 01:16:21 __uguu__ in general on the webserver 01:18:00 __uguu__ i spawned a few requests 01:26:22 __uguu__ n-tech: your site's not working D: 01:26:54 n-tech hm? 01:27:02 __uguu__ i keep getting 502s 01:27:14 n-tech It works but it's lagging out. I wonder if there's a denial of service attack. 01:27:16 n-tech Are you doing something? 01:27:21 __uguu__ i am loading webms 01:28:03 n-tech You're definitely doing something. What is your request cycle? 01:28:11 __uguu__ if i can disrupt it this bad over tor.... 01:28:18 __uguu__ and OVER TOR 01:28:43 n-tech You're hitting a 4 core server that's shared with a forum that has 500 active users 01:28:44 __uguu__ request cycle, connect, load webm, repeat 01:29:01 __uguu__ it's that beefy? 01:29:04 n-tech and a wiki 01:29:12 __uguu__ dang you should optimize this shit 01:29:36 __uguu__ it shouldn't be this to skid down infinity-next 01:29:38 n-tech How many connections? 01:29:50 n-tech Or is it just one? 01:30:15 __uguu__ 45 01:30:19 __uguu__ thasit 01:30:30 __uguu__ seriously urshitsux 01:30:45 n-tech I'm sure it's unoptimized you dip I just fucking wrote it 01:30:50 n-tech You're disruptive service to the forum now 01:31:01 __uguu__ i am just requesting the webm realy fast :3 01:31:23 __uguu__ you should serve media statically just sayin 01:31:33 n-tech yes, that's an application level denial of service attack. I understand what you're doing. 01:31:40 n-tech That's an option but there's more fun to be had controlling the content. 01:31:51 n-tech It's just an issue with the scripts being too trustworthy. 01:31:52 __uguu__ apply imagefilters too 01:32:05 __uguu__ that way the server can get bogged down with only 2 requests a second 01:32:09 __uguu__ lol 01:32:27 __uguu__ Bui: infinity-next test server can be swamped really easy and over tor 01:32:34 __uguu__ this is make me sads 01:32:46 __uguu__ it really shouldn't be that easy 01:32:57 n-tech It's almost as if alpha software with new media features that got developed less than an hour ago are somehow vulnerable or ineffecient. 01:33:17 n-tech Now I have to move this shit off to its own server so you don't fucking attack my forum 01:33:21 __uguu__ yeah but that's not really a good excuse even the tox people know this 01:33:22 n-tech This is why I don't ask you for help. 01:33:35 StephenLynx addon support complete :3 01:34:00 __uguu__ StephenLynx: do you serve media statically? 01:34:15 StephenLynx what do you mean? 01:34:21 __uguu__ as in via a webserver 01:34:24 __uguu__ not iojs 01:34:29 StephenLynx via io.js. 01:34:31 Bui >using tor for spamming 01:34:35 Bui desperate mode 01:34:37 StephenLynx streaming from the database.